Last year’s reimagining/reboot of beloved PC classic X-Com: UFO Defense, X-Com: Enemy Unknown, was an incredible game, modernizing the old formula for contemporary sensibilities whilst still retaining its sense of identity. It was an excellent strategy game from a developer who is undoubtedly the master of the genre.

Of course, we don’t know whether the game will get a proper sequel- the upcoming The Bureau: X-Com doesn’t (and shouldn’t) really count, as it’s barely part of the same universe and not even the same genre. Looks like those fears might just have been put to rest by recent finds.

These recent finds are listings for X-Com: Enemy Within on Steam Databases, and on the Korean Classification Board’s website, which indicates that whatever it is, it is for PS3, Xbox 360, and PC. I say ‘whatever it is’ because we are not sure yet if it’s a new game, or an expansion; the name certainly seems to indicate the latter.
